Forge Cottage Tonbridge Road, Barming, Maidstone, ME16 9NH is a freehold detached property built before 1900. The property offers approximately 1,851 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have six b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£720,004 , which equates to approximately £389 per square foot. It was last sold on 23 Jun 2022 for £696,100. Since then, the value has increased by £23,904, representing a 3.4% increase, or approximately 1.0% per year.

Forge Cottage Tonbridge Road, Barming, Maidstone, Kent, ME16 9NH has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of D, based on the latest assessment carried out on 28 Oct 2016.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 28 Jul 2016. The rating of D is unchanged, though the energy efficiency score decreased by 16.4%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, insulated (assumed) to pitched, insulated at rafters, changing energy efficiency from average to very poor.
  • The wall construction or insulation changed from cavity wall, filled cavity to solid brick, as built, no insulation (assumed), changing energy efficiency from good to very poor.
  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in 33% of fixed outlets to low energy lighting in 56% of f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from average to good.
